- MOVIETONE CARD TITLE: New Thames Tunnel. DESCRIPTION: It wasn’t until 1938 that a pilot tunnel between Purfleet and Dartford was actually completed. Now work has started again and Mr Nugent, the Minister of Transport’s Parliamentary Secretary went down 80 feet below the surface to the workings at the Dartford end, to inaugurate the scheme. The new underwater link between Kent and Essex will cost roughly £11,000,000 and should be finished within 5 years. SHOTLIST: GV Thames looking across to Purfleet. Slip pan to map of project.
